About Lisa

Lisa Badman-Dunphy is a BACP-registered psychotherapeutic counsellor based in the United Kingdom. BACP registration means she is a member of the British Association for Counselling and Psychotherapy, the professional body for counsellors in the UK. She has four years of experience working as a counsellor, and prior to qualifying she spent over 20 years working with the NHS and other care providers in areas including health visiting, sexual health, older persons mental health, and special educational needs and disabilities.

She supports people who are coping with stress, anxiety, depression, low self-esteem, intimacy-related concerns, relationship and family difficulties, grief, trauma and abuse, eating and body-image issues, parenting and career challenges, ADHD, and broader life transitions. Additional focuses include abandonment and attachment issues, blended family dynamics, caregiver stress, chronic illness and disability, codependency, communication problems, and separation or divorce. She also works with communities that identify as BIPOC, body positive, open-relationship or ethically non-monogamous, LGBTQIA+, and sex positive.

Working from a psychodynamic perspective, Lisa explores the roots of emotions, thoughts, and behaviours to help people understand how past experiences shape the present. Her practice centers on openness, empathy, and respect, offering a supportive, non-judgmental space for reflection and growth. She provides one-to-one sessions by phone and online, typically meeting once a week and offering short-term or open-ended work depending on individual needs. Psychodynamic work and flexible online sessions



Psychodynamic therapy explores how past experiences, early relationships, and unconscious patterns influence current feelings and behaviours. It helps clients identify repeating themes in relationships, understand sources of anxiety or low self-esteem, and develop greater self-awareness to support lasting change. Psychotherapeutic counselling and talk-based work focus on creating a reflective space where thoughts and emotions can be explored in relation to life challenges such as grief, trauma, or major transitions.

Finding the right approach is a collaborative process. The therapist works with each person to assess needs, goals, and preferences and will adapt the way of working over time to find the best fit. Clients and the therapist decide together whether shorter-term focused work or more open-ended exploration is most helpful.
